Cylinder Burl Walnut Pedestal Cabinet, Copenhagen, 1830-1840

About the Item

Cylinder burl walnut pedestal cabinet. Late empire. Oak beautifully veneered with walnut. A large front door that opens to reveal a set of four shelves. Copenhagen, 1830-1840.
  • Dimensions:
    Height: 57.88 in (147 cm)Width: 23.63 in (60 cm)Depth: 15.75 in (40 cm)
